### MinGW/CygWin compilation (linking) is extremely slow
Compiling Catch2 with MinGW can be exceedingly slow, especially during
the linking step. As far as we can tell, this is caused by deficiencies
in its default linker. If you can tell MinGW to instead use lld, via
`-fuse-ld=lld`, the link time should drop down to reasonable length
again.

## 2.10.2
### Improvements
* Catch2 will now compile on platform where `INFINITY` is double (#1782)
### Fixes
* Warning suppressed during listener registration will no longer leak
## 2.10.1
### Improvements
* Catch2 now guards itself against `min` and `max` macros from `windows.h` (#1772)
* Templated tests will now compile with ICC (#1748)
* `WithinULP` matcher now uses scientific notation for stringification (#1760)
### Fixes
* Templated tests no longer trigger `-Wunused-templates` (#1762)
* Suppressed clang-analyzer false positive in context getter (#1230, #1735)
### Miscellaneous
* CMake no longer prohibits in-tree build when Catch2 is used as a subproject (#1773, #1774)
